Trailer Hitch Fit For 2015 Ford Fiesta ST Hatchback  

Question:

I own a 2015 Fiesta ST and was wondering about fitment with the OEM rear splitter. I am pretty sure some cutting would be necessary. I am also curious about approximate receiver height. Trailer pulled will be apprx 1000 lbs, with a 100 lb tongue weight. Thanks.

0

Expert Reply:

The 2015 Ford Fiesta ST is the hatchback model, and we have a trailer hitch is confirmed to fit. You would need the Curt Trailer Hitch Receiver # C11067. The accompanying photo is of a hitch on a Fiesta; I have also added a link to an install video so you can see exactly what you'll need to do. The only trimming you'll need to do is a 2" section of the heat shield which means there is no fascia trimming needed at all.

Since you mentioned you will be towing there is a specific ball mount you will need, the Curt Class II Drawbar # C45521 is recommended for the Curt hitch. You will also need the Pin and Clip # F-4. For a hitch ball you can use 1-7/8" Hitch Ball # A-80 or 2" Hitch Ball # A-82 depending on the size of your trailer's coupler.

Finally, you will also need wiring to power your trailer's lights and for a 2015 Ford Fiesta ST hatchback the compatible wiring harness is the Curt T-Connector Vehicle Wiring Harness # C56191.
